The Weatherby Mark V Backcountry Guide is a purpose-built bolt-action hunting rifle chambered in 6.5 Creedmoor and engineered for hunters who cover big country on foot. Built on Weatherby's legendary Mark V action, this rifle pairs a precision 22" fluted, threaded barrel with the company's Accubrake ST muzzle brake (adding 2" to overall length) to effectively manage recoil without piling unnecessary weight out at the muzzle.
At the heart of the Backcountry Guide is a steel receiver machined to Weatherby's tight tolerances and fitted with a premium TriggerTech trigger for a clean, crisp break. The action is paired with a two-position safety and a 1:8" twist barrel optimized to stabilize the wide range of 6.5 Creedmoor bullet weights used in modern hunting and long-range shooting. With a 3+1 capacity fed from an internal box magazine, the rifle ships with no iron sights installed, leaving the receiver ready for the shooter to mount their preferred optic.
The stock is a lightweight Fixed Peak 44 Blacktooth in camouflage finish, designed to cut weight and blend into western big-game terrain. At just 5.60 lbs and 44" overall, the Backcountry Guide is a true mountain rifle that can be carried all day without fatigue, yet still delivers the accuracy and reliability that have defined the Mark V line for decades. This model is configured for right-hand shooters.
